Redis集群节点扩容,实现更高效服务(redis集群节点的增加)
Redis集群节点扩容是提高Redis服务能力时必要采用的方案之一,它能够实现更高效的服务,让Redis更稳定、更可靠、更性能。下面,将介绍如何对Redis集群节点进行扩容,并介绍扩容过程中遇到的一些常见问题。
将说明Redis集群节点扩容的内容,即增加节点的步骤。
在集群中创建新的节点,默认情况下,Redis的每个节点的内存为4GB,如果这不够用,可以在创建节点时进行配置。
然后,将新节点添加到集群中,这需要使用Redis集群管理命令,例如:`CLUSTER ADDNODE ip:port node_name`,在添加节点时,也可以指定要添加的节点的master-slave关系。
启用新节点,这是通过CLUSTER JOIN命令来实现的,用于将新节点加入集群,并释放其内存;此外,还可以通过CLUSTER REBALANCE命令动态调整集群的负载,使得负载会根据已有的节点的负载情况动态的进行分配。
Redis扩容时可能遇到的一些问题也是需要注意的,如:需要考虑数据迁移,在扩容之前,需要检查当前集群内部数据是否有迁移以及如何迁移;此外,还需要考虑集群中子节点版本,新节点应当与用于创建集群的节点版本一致;另外,也要考虑Redis服务是否能够正确重启,以及是否可以使用相关管理工具进行集群管理。
通过以上步骤,Redis集群节点就可以进行扩容了,能够更高效的支持Redis服务。但应当注意,上述过程中要注意一些可能遇到的问题,及时处理这些问题,以保证Redis服务的稳定和可靠性。